Hayri Köktürk, Istanbul, Turkey; Gül Gürsoy, Istanbul, Turkey; Özgür Akyildiz, Lasne, Belgium; Ahmet Halilbeyoglu, Istanbul, Turkey; Pek Gökmen, Istanbul, Turkey; Hans-Joerg Hufnagel, Bonn, Germany; and Helen Assenheimer, Sinzheim, Germany.
Assigned to Ontex BVBA, Buggenhout, Belgium; and Ontex Group NV, Erembodegem, Belgium.
Filed: 8/26/16
Issued: 3/31/20
An absorbent hygiene article suitable to be worn around the waist of a wearer, the article comprising: a front region, a back region and a crotch region located longitudinally in between the front region and the back region; a liquid impermeable backsheet on a garment-facing side of the article, a liquid permeable topsheet on the body-facing side of the article and an absorbent core therebetween, the absorbent core substantially located in the crotch region; a leakage barrier comprising a pair of leg cuffs arranged longitudinally on the body-facing side of the article from the front region to the back region across the crotch region, a first leg cuff of said pair of leg cuffs being arranged near a first leg-hole-defining-edge of the article and a second leg cuff of said pair of leg cuffs being arranged near a second leg-hole-defining-edge of the article, each of the leg cuffs comprising a front end edge located in the front region, a back end edge located in the back region, a longitudinal proximal edge near a leg-hole-defining-edge of the article and attached to the topsheet, and a longitudinal distal edge substantially unattached for allowing the corresponding leg cuff to be lifted over the topsheet to create a longitudinal upstanding barrier, wherein each of the leg cuffs comprises one or more elastic members, the elastic members being arranged longitudinally near the distal edge of the leg cuff, wherein the leakage barrier further comprises: a front barrier located in the front region, the front barrier comprising a first front barrier edge attached to the first leg cuff near the distal edge of the first leg cuff, the front barrier comprising a second front barrier edge attached to the second leg cuff near the distal edge of the second leg cuff, the front barrier comprising a front barrier waist edge attached to the topsheet near a front waist edge of the article and the front barrier comprising a front barrier internal edge substantially unattached for allowing the front barrier to be lifted over the topsheet when the distal edges of the leg cuffs are also lifted over the topsheet, to create a transverse upstanding barrier in the front region of the article; and/or a back barrier located in the back region, the back barrier comprising a first back barrier edge attached to the first leg cuff near the distal edge of the first leg cuff, the back barrier comprising a second back barrier edge attached to the second leg cuff near the distal edge of the second leg cuff, the back barrier comprising a back barrier waist edge attached to the topsheet near a back waist edge of the article and the back barrier comprising a back barrier internal edge substantially unattached for allowing the back barrier to be lifted over the topsheet when the distal edges of the leg cuffs are also lifted over the topsheet, to create a transverse upstanding barrier in the back region of the article, characterized in that the front barrier and/or the back barrier comprises a liquid-impermeable nonwoven sheet comprising a weight of at most 18 gsm and in that the elastic members of the leg cuffs do not overlap with the front barrier and/or the back barrier, and wherein the front barrier and/or the back barrier does not comprise an elastic member.
